Abstract

The utility model discloses a head fixing device for neurosurgery, including the bottom plate, the bottom plate upside is rotated and is connected solid fixed ring, and gu fixed ring is inside to be equipped with the step groove, is equipped with locking mechanism in the fixed ring, and locking mechanism includes the ring, and the ring is placed at step groove upside, and the even a set of shell fragment of fixed connection of upside of ring, gu the fixed ring inboard is equipped with the screw thread, the inboard threaded connection clamping ring of solid fixed ring, the clamping ring can contact with one side of shell fragment towards solid fixed ring inner wall, and the bottom plate upside is equipped with angle adjustment. The utility model has the advantages that: the compression ring is rotated to move in the fixed ring to extrude the elastic sheet, and the head of the patient is fixed by contracting or loosening the elastic sheet, so that the structure is simple, the operation is convenient, and the practicability is better; a rubber pad is fixedly bonded on one side of the elastic sheet, so that the comfort level of a patient when the elastic sheet is contacted with the head of the patient is improved; the angle of the head of the patient can be properly adjusted through the angle adjusting mechanism, so that a doctor can conveniently make a diagnosis and treat.

Detailed Description
In order to make the objects, technical solutions and advantages of the present invention more apparent, the present invention will be described in further detail with reference to the accompanying drawings and embodiments. It should be understood that the specific embodiments described herein are merely illustrative of the invention and are not intended to limit the invention.
As shown in figures 1-3, the utility model provides a head fixing device for neurosurgery, which comprises a bottom plate 1, the upper side of the bottom plate 1 is fixedly connected with two base plates 6 through bolts, each base plate 6 is provided with a rotating hole, each rotating hole is internally and rotatably connected with a rotating shaft 7, a fixing ring 2 is welded and fixed between the two rotating shafts 7, one end inside the fixing ring 2 is provided with a step groove, the fixing ring 2 is internally provided with a locking mechanism, the locking mechanism comprises a circular ring 3, the circular ring 3 is placed on the upper side of the step groove, the upper side of the circular ring 3 is uniformly and fixedly connected with a group of elastic sheets 4, the upper ends of the elastic sheets 4 incline towards the circle center of the circular ring 3, the inner side of the fixing ring 2 is provided with threads, the inner side of the fixing ring 2 is connected with a pressing ring 5 through threads, the pressing ring 5 can be in contact with, 1 upside of bottom plate is equipped with angle adjustment mechanism, it rotates 5 rotations of drive clamping ring to rotate handle 14, 5 threaded connection of clamping ring in solid fixed ring 2's inboard, downstream in the time of 5 pivoted clamping ring, 4 one sides towards solid fixed ring 2 inner walls of extrusion shell fragment, make shell fragment 4 keep away from the one end of ring 3 and draw close mutually, fix patient's head with this, shell fragment 4 bonds towards one side in the 3 centre of a circle of ring and is fixed with the rubber pad, patient's comfort level when the rubber pad can improve the shell fragment and contact patient's head.
The angle adjusting mechanism comprises a semicircular gear 8, the gear 8 is fixedly welded at the bottom of the outer wall of the fixed ring 2, a dovetail-shaped sliding groove 9 is arranged at the upper side of the bottom plate 1, a sliding block 10 is connected in the sliding groove 9 in a sliding mode, a fixed rack 11 is welded at the upper side of the sliding block 10, the rack 11 is meshed with the gear 8, a threaded hole is formed in each of two ends of the sliding groove 9, a threaded rod 12 is connected in each threaded hole in a threaded mode, one end of each threaded rod 12 extends out of the outer side of the bottom plate 1 from the threaded hole and is fixedly connected with a hand wheel 13 through a bolt, when a doctor needs to properly adjust the head elevation angle of a patient, the hand wheel 13 of one threaded rod 12 is rotated to enable one end of the threaded rod 12 not to be in contact with the sliding block 10, then the hand wheel 13 of the other threaded rod 12 is, the rack 11 drives the fixed ring 2 to rotate when moving, and after the fixed ring 2 rotates to a proper angle, the hand wheel 13 is rotated to push the two threaded rods 12 to the two ends of the sliding block 10 respectively, so that the sliding block 10 is prevented from sliding, the angle of the fixed ring 2 is fixed, and a doctor can diagnose and treat conveniently.
The upper side of the bottom plate is provided with a group of through mounting holes 15, and the device can be fixed on an operating table or a diagnostic table through the mounting holes 15.
When the operation table is used, the head of a patient extends into the fixing ring 2, the handle 14 is rotated to drive the compression ring 5 to rotate, the compression ring 5 is in threaded connection with the inner side of the fixing ring 2, the compression ring 5 moves downwards while rotating, one side of the elastic sheet 4 facing the inner wall of the fixing ring 2 is extruded, one end of the elastic sheet 4 far away from the circular ring 3 is made to approach each other, the head of the patient is fixed, the operation can be performed after the fixation, when the elevation angle of the head of the patient needs to be properly adjusted, the hand wheel 13 of one threaded rod 12 is rotated, one end of the threaded rod 12 is made not to be in contact with the sliding block 10, then the hand wheel 13 of the other threaded rod 12 is rotated, one end of the threaded rod 12 continuously extrudes the sliding block 10, the sliding block 10 moves in the sliding groove 9, the rack 11 moves along with the sliding block 10, the rack, the hand wheel 13 is rotated to push the two threaded rods 12 to the two ends of the slider 10 respectively, so that the slider 10 is prevented from sliding, and the angle of the fixing ring 2 is fixed, so that a doctor can conveniently diagnose and treat.
To sum up, the utility model provides a head fixing device for neurosurgery has solved that present head operation carries out the headstock project organization that fixes to the head complicated, and complex operation needs the longer time just can accomplish this kind of technical problem fixed to the head.
